North Carolina Child Treatment Program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at North Carolina Child Treatment Program in the United States is $81,610.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$39. Salaries at North Carolina Child Treatment Program typically range from $71,366 to $93,381 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About North Carolina Child Treatment Program
The North Carolina Child Treatment Program is a statewide effort to train clinicians in evidence-based treatment models addressing childhood trauma.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Durham?

Understanding the cost of living near Durham is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at North Carolina Child Treatment Program.
Durham's Cost of Living Index is approximately 101.5 (1.5% more expensive than US average; 5.7% more than NC average). Research Triangle Park (Duke Univ.), revitalized downtown, housing above US avg. GoDurham/GoTriangle. When planning your budget based on a salary from North Carolina Child Treatment Program,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,350 - $2,000+ A significant portion of North Carolina Child Treatment Program sal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$140 - $230 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$60 (GoDurham mon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$400 - $590 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$400 - $730+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$380 - $700+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,730 - $4,250+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
